Here are some before and after pictures of the work. Mid County Mustang did a wonderful job on my mustang. I am more then happy with the quality of work.

Basic Repair List:
Both Rear Torque Boxes
Both Inner Rocker Panels
Complete Floor Pans
Both Rear Frame Rails
Patches on the front Frame Rails
Firewall repair

REVIEW (1-10, 10 being the best)
PRICE:
9
For the amount of rust, I'm sure you can find slightly cheaper, but for the quality of work, You'd be hard pressed to match the price. Mid County Mustang was on the low end of all estimates.
QUALITY OF WORK:
9.9
The only reason I don't give it a 10 is for some of the clean up issues. There was a lot of metal dust in the car, and the fact that the heater wire was incorrectly hooked up. VERY VERY minor stuff. The actual repair work was some of the best I've ever seen.

OVERALL
HAPPINESS
FACTOR

10

Mid County Mustang was a shere pleasure to work with. Great price, great work. Their quote was almost dead on. They found $200 worth of repairs that needed to be done that they didn't see at first (actually, couldn't see at all until they got in there). For a $5k estimate, being $200 off is pretty good. They even called for permission to conduct the additional work, and told me it wasn't 100% neccesary, just recommended. I recommend anyone who needs frame repair that is within a few hours of Philadelphia, PA to them. I have more frame repairs to do later, and my car will be making the trek from Boston to Philly just so they can work on it.
